Output 893370eee5027200683520d51475d5b04ea9a93bb8b1368ef7bfd2ba8f0371fb:0

value
70000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99713e8064d04aeb36bbe30661c3a41cc3198b89 OP_EQUAL
address
MMtVH7zx8fw7DmCSRkX9ZNyRhaS73ymjDJ
transaction
893370eee5027200683520d51475d5b04ea9a93bb8b1368ef7bfd2ba8f0371fb
spent
true